Abstract

Based on research funded by the Crafts Council, this paper examines the changing context of craft-based design education, and seeks to test the proposition that crafts education is providing the skills and qualities most required of people in the emerging information society. After reviewing relevant research and pespectives, the paper identifies an agenda for a continuing programme of research.
